
The Enhanced Games is meant to be the first event of its kind to support performance-enhancing drugs and not follow the rules of the World Anti-Doping Agency (WADA).[6] Performance enhancing drugs will not be mandatory for participants.[7][8] Such an event has been discussed hypothetically for many years, but never been realised.[9][10][11] Prosthetic limbs and shoe technology will be allowed.[5]
The event, announced in June 2023, is intended to be annual and to include track and field, swimming, weightlifting, gymnastics, and combat sports. Originally planned for December 2024,[12][13][14] a specific date and location are not set as of February 2024,[15] and the number of athletes "maybe a couple of thousand" according to a representative.[1] Brett Fraser, chief athletics officer of the organisation, says that the planned included sports are a "core suite of products", and can be improved upon in the future.[8] The scale will depend on funding and the location is planned to be a university campus or similar facility in the southern United States.[16] Aron D'Souza, president of the organisation, said in early 2024 that he now had the equity capital to fund the first event.[5]
By August 2023, representatives were saying that what would take place in 2024 would be a smaller "exhibition", with a "full event" taking place in 2025.[11][14] In February 2024, D'Souza said that recent events "accelerates all of our timelines."[17] CNN said in October 2023 that it was an open question whether the games would ever take place.[16]
